Smoky Hill Vineyards & Winery originated in 1991 by founders Steve Jennings and Kay Bloom. They hand-planted the first vines on a one-acre field in Salina, Kansas. The founders eventually passed on the well-established craft to George Plante, his daughter, Nicki, and her husband, Brock, in November 2012. The Saline River is a 397-mile-long (639 km) [3] tributary of the Smoky Hill River in the central Great Plains of North America. The entire length of the river lies in the U.S. state of Kansas in the northwest part of the state. The elevation in Kansas drops gradually from west to east. There are more hills and more changes in topography further east. The central regions of Kansas are home to the Smoky Hills, the Arkansas River Valley, and the Red Hills. Landsat 8 satellite imagery of the state of Kansas. Imagery: USGS, public domain.Monument Rocks and Chalk Pyramids are names for the same group of rock outcroppings, near US-83 in western Kansas. There are signs at the turn off (6 miles of gravel roads) from both north and south. Monument Rocks can be seen in the distance from highway US-83 if you know where to look. The 70 feet tall sedimentary formations of Niobrara Chalk ...

Kansas contains no deserts as scientifically defined as barren areas with little rainfall.
